Dear BioC, I want to perform a Significance Analysis for Microarray, SAM, and I wonder which package to use. I read the vignette from "siggenes" package, but there is no way to implement fold change, FC, in the analysis as defaut. I subindexed the eset, according to fold change, of gens, but of course in this way I will affect the results of the permutation test. Is this the correct way to perform SAM, or I shold move to "samr"? is it package able to handle FC analysis in a different way? Hi Claudio, by default, the fold change is computed in sam (it is called R.fold in the output). However, the fold change can also be used as a filtering criterion (similar to what Tusher et al. do) by specifying R.fold in sam by another value than 1. For details, see the argument R.fold in the help of sam.dstat.
